Mississippi is about 2.4 times bigger than Bosnia and Herzegovina.

Bosnia and Herzegovina is approximately 51,197 sq km, while Mississippi is approximately 121,489 sq km, making Mississippi 137% larger than Bosnia and Herzegovina. Meanwhile, the population of Bosnia and Herzegovina is ~3.8 million people (849,162 fewer people live in Mississippi).
This to-scale comparison of Bosnia and Herzegovina vs. Mississippi uses the Mercator projection, which distorts the size of regions near the poles. Learn more.
